#include <stdio.h>
#include <stdlib.h>
main()
{
char arr[20] ={'h','e','l','l','o','\0'};//char数组表示字符串很麻烦
// 利用char类型指针 方便的表示一个字符串
char* arr1= "hello world";
printf("%s",arr1); //%s是字符串的占位符 arr1是一个地址
system("pause"); // 调用windows下系统的命令 让程序暂停执行 方便观察程序的执行结果
}
分享到:
相关推荐
- 字符数组与字符串:了解字符串在C语言中的表示,以及strcat, strcmp, strcpy等字符串函数的用法。 4. 指针: - 指针基本概念:理解指针的声明,指针变量的初始化和解引用操作。 - 指针与数组:比较指针和数组...
"c语言复习资料-历年试卷"是华中科技大学为帮助学生备考而整理的一份宝贵资源,包含了历年来的试题,对于学习C语言的人来说,这是一个很好的自我测试和复习的工具。 这份压缩包文件可能包含多套试卷,每套试卷都是...
### C语言复习纲要 #### 一、概述 本文档主要针对大一学生使用谭浩强版《C程序设计》教材的学习者进行期末复习时所准备的复习资料。该资料适用于初学者快速回顾并掌握C语言的核心概念和技术要点,帮助学生在考试中...
本压缩包“C语言复习题-1.zip”包含了多个文档和一个PPT课件,旨在帮助学习者巩固和提升C语言的知识点。下面我们将详细探讨这些文档可能涵盖的C语言知识点。 1. **基本语法**:C语言的基础包括变量定义、数据类型...
标题 "C语言复习1-C++.zip" 暗示了这是一个关于C语言学习资料的压缩包,其中可能包含了与C语言基础、进阶概念以及与C++相关的学习资源。C语言是计算机科学的基础,而C++是C语言的增强版,引入了面向对象编程的概念。...
以下是对C语言复习大纲的详细解析: 1. **C语言概述** - C语言起源于贝尔实验室,由Dennis Ritchie在1972年设计,为了解决UNIX操作系统编程的需求。 - C语言的主要特点包括:结构化、低级特性、运行效率高、可...
* 声明并初始化一个指针变量start,将其指向传入的字符串str的起始位置。 * 使用断言assert(str != NULL)来确保传入的字符串指针不为空,以防止出现空指针异常。 * 进入循环,条件为*str,即只要当前字符不是字符串...
【C语言09-10年试题】是一个关于C语言的考试资料集合,主要涵盖了2009年至2010年间举行的二级C语言等级考试的试题与答案。这些资源对于学习者来说是非常宝贵的,可以帮助他们熟悉考试的题型、难度以及解题策略,从而...
第二部分则深入到数组、指针、字符和字符串、结构和共用体、变量的作用域、输入/输出等更进阶的概念。到了第三周,教材转向高级主题,涵盖指针和函数的高级应用、文件读写、字符操作函数、标准库函数、内存管理以及...
- **解释**: 字符数组可以直接初始化或赋值为一个字符串常量,但不能直接赋值为另一个字符串变量,除非使用`strcpy()`函数。 **9. 字符串操作** - **知识点**: 字符串的索引和访问。 - **解释**: 字符数组可以通过...
程序通过两个指针`i`和`j`遍历字符串,`i`用于读取字符串,`j`用于记录新字符串的位置。只有当遇到非空格字符时,才将其复制到新位置,并更新`j`。最后,用`\0`结束新字符串。 5. **编程题(1)**:该题要求填充...
【C语言复习笔记-day3】 在C语言的学习中,我们继续深入探讨了各种核心概念。以下是一些重要的知识点总结: 1. **printf 函数**:`printf`是用于输出格式化字符串的函数,若要使其在窗口停留更长时间,可以使用...
`strcpy`函数用于复制一个字符串到另一个字符串中。例如: ```c char dest[10]; char src[] = "abcdef"; strcpy(dest, src); ``` 这里需要注意的是,`dest`数组的大小应该足够大以容纳`src`字符串以及结束符`\0`。 ...
计算机二级C语言考试是中国计算机技术与软件专业技术资格(水平)考试中的一个重要部分,主要针对希望掌握C语言编程基础和程序设计能力的考生。这个压缩包包含的是从第19次到第30次的笔试试题及答案,是备考者进行...
标题和描述部分提到的“C语言复习知识点.pdf”意味着接下来的内容将...内容中有些许OCR扫描错误,但整体信息足以构建出一份C语言复习的要点。在学习C语言时,理解这些基本概念和特性对于编写有效和高效的代码至关重要。
通过以上实验,你可以深入理解C语言中的指针操作,包括指针变量的声明、初始化,通过指针访问和修改数组、字符串,以及在函数中传递地址等高级用法。熟练掌握这些知识点对于理解和编写复杂的C语言程序至关重要。
本资源摘要信息涵盖了C语言复习专用题集的主要知识点,涵盖了C语言程序设计概述、数据类型及其运算、语句与输入输出、选择结构程序设计、循环结构程序设计、数组、函数、指针、结构体与共用体、文件等方面的知识点,...
从给定的C语言复习资料习题中,我们可以总结出一系列重要的C语言知识点,涵盖循环控制、数组操作、字符串处理、变量存储、预处理器、数据类型、指针使用以及字符和ASCII码的理解。 1. **循环控制** - **死循环**:...
总之,这份"C语言复习资料及习题和答案"是一份全面的C语言学习资源,不仅包含了C语言的基础知识,还有实践性的习题和解答,对于学习者而言,是提升C语言能力的宝贵资料。通过深入学习和实践,你将能够熟练地驾驭...
在这些编程题目中,我们可以看到涉及了C语言的基础知识,包括输入输出、变量、运算符、函数、指针以及字符串处理。以下是对每个题目中所体现的知识点的详细解释: 1. **编程题 2** - 这个题目是关于货币兑换的。它...